VPN-based Future Internet that prevents routing table size explosion (3) -- ISP networks built over one or more carrier networks --
Hisao Furukawa (DSRI), Shoji Miyaguchi (formerly NTT) IA2011-21
Abstract (in Japanese) (See Japanese page) 
(in English) We have determined how to suppress the expansion of routing table size of routers that form the Internet. Original ID/locator separation splits the functionalities of the IP address into ID and locator, in which the ID identifies the end point of a circuit, while the locator indicates the direction of IP packet transfer. The current Internet user interface remains unchanged, (the future Internet is compatible with the current Internet), i.e. our idea ensures communication between IP nodes (hosts), those connecting to the current Internet and those to any future Internet. Carriers build ISP networks, which are virtual networks made of VPN tunnels, as networks that overlay their networks. Access networks and/or sites managed by ISPs, spatial neighbors, are divided into one or more regions. ISPs collect IP packets that end users send through access networks, transfer the IP packets inside a region, or among regions, across VPN tunnels provided by the carriers. ISPs utilize the network functions offered by carriers, to set and release VPN tunnels.
